i thought corsa sports are 236mm? astra gte setup is 256mm
Kris TD
Member

Registered: 25th Mar 02
Location: Ware, Hertfordshire
User status: Offline
18th Mar 03 at 13:01   View User's Profile U2U Member Reply With Quote

1.4 sport is 236 x 20, 1.6 sport and gsi is 256 x 20, astra gte is 256mm x 24mm
